Default Colts and OT Braden Smith agree to 4 year contract extension

Reportedly a 4 year deal worth up to 72MM with approximately 42MM guaranteed.

The Colts and OT Braden Smith have agreed to a four-year extension worth $72.4 million, including $70 million in new money and $42 million guaranteed, per source. Indy locks up big-time tackle.

Not bad for a guy who was drafted to play guard. Chris Ballard had to be convinced to give him a shot at tackle — and now he's one of the best in the game.

One of just 3 tackles to play 900 snaps and not allow a sack in 2020.
